Urban Rooftop Farming Systems Market Overview

The Urban Rooftop Farming Systems market has evolved rapidly over recent years as urbanization, rising environmental awareness, and technological advancements converge to create new opportunities for local food production. Cities worldwide are embracing rooftop farming as a sustainable solution to reduce food miles, mitigate urban heat islands, and improve local economies. Key drivers include increased consumer demand for fresh produce, supportive government policies, and innovative farming techniques such as hydroponics and aeroponics. Meanwhile, challenges such as high installation costs, regulatory hurdles, and the need for specialized technological integrations persist. Urban Rooftop Farming Systems Market Analysis Report by Region

Europe Urban Rooftop Farming Systems:

Europe shows promising growth in the rooftop farming market, increasing from about $1.47 billion in 2024 to $2.80 billion by 2033. The region benefits from stringent environmental policies, technological advancements, and high consumer awareness regarding sustainability, ensuring a vibrant market landscape and strong investor interest.

Asia Pacific Urban Rooftop Farming Systems:

In the Asia Pacific region, urban rooftop farms are emerging as a solution to counter space constraints and food security issues. With the market growing from an estimated $0.72 billion in 2024 to $1.37 billion by 2033, regional investments focus on technology integration and innovative urban planning. Rapid economic growth and government initiatives promote sustainable agriculture, making this region a key growth driver.

North America Urban Rooftop Farming Systems:

North America leads in adopting advanced urban agriculture practices, with market figures rising from an estimated $1.65 billion in 2024 to $3.15 billion by 2033. Technological innovations, coupled with a robust regulatory framework and consumer demand for fresh produce, position the region as a frontrunner in the rooftop farming sector.

South America Urban Rooftop Farming Systems:

South America is witnessing steady market growth, with rooftop farming systems gaining traction as cities seek sustainable agricultural practices. Although starting from a smaller base of approximately $0.43 billion in 2024, the region is projected to grow to $0.82 billion by 2033. Urban centers are progressively investing in green technologies to address food security and environmental concerns.

Middle East & Africa Urban Rooftop Farming Systems:

In the Middle East and Africa, the market is emerging, growing from an estimated $0.22 billion in 2024 to $0.43 billion by 2033. Rising urbanization, combined with governmental support for green infrastructure, is fostering interest in rooftop farming systems as part of broader sustainability initiatives across the region.

Urban Rooftop Farming Systems Market Analysis By System Type

Global Urban Rooftop Farming Systems Market, By System Type Market Analysis (2024 - 2033)

The analysis by system type focuses on cultivation methodologies, particularly hydroponics, aeroponics, and soil-based systems. Hydroponics leads with a projected market growth from a size of 2.71 in 2024 to 5.16 in 2033, capturing approximately 60.18% of the share due to its efficient water use and higher yield potential. Aeroponics and soil-based systems, while smaller in initial investment, follow a similar growth trajectory, offering cost-effective alternatives. These systems are innovating continuously, leveraging modular designs and IoT integration to optimize production and reduce maintenance. The shift towards technology-driven agriculture is ensuring that each system type adapts to urban constraints while meeting the increasing demand for local, fresh produce.
